| package javax.xml.rpc.server; |
| |
| import javax.xml.rpc.ServiceException; |
| |
| /** |
| * The <code>javax.xml.rpc.server.ServiceLifecycle</code> defines a lifecycle interface for a |
| * JAX-RPC service endpoint. If the service endpoint class implements the |
| * <code>ServiceLifeycle</code> interface, the servlet container based JAX-RPC runtime system |
| * is required to manage the lifecycle of the corresponding service endpoint objects. |
| * |
| * @version 1.0 |
| */ |
| public interface ServiceLifecycle { |
| |
| /** |
| * Used for initialization of a service endpoint. After a service |
| * endpoint instance (an instance of a service endpoint class) is |
| * instantiated, the JAX-RPC runtime system invokes the |
| * <code>init</code> method. The service endpoint class uses the |
| * <code>init</code> method to initialize its configuration |
| * and setup access to any external resources. The context parameter |
| * in the <code>init</code> method enables the endpoint instance to |
| * access the endpoint context provided by the underlying JAX-RPC |
| * runtime system. |
| * <p> |
| * The init method implementation should typecast the context |
| * parameter to an appropriate Java type. For service endpoints |
| * deployed on a servlet container based JAX-RPC runtime system, |
| * the <code>context</code> parameter is of the Java type |
| * <code>javax.xml.rpc.server.ServletEndpointContext</code>. The |
| * <code>ServletEndpointContext</code> provides an endpoint context |
| * maintained by the underlying servlet container based JAX-RPC |
| * runtime system |
| * <p> |
| * @param context Endpoint context for a JAX-RPC service endpoint |
| * @throws ServiceException If any error in initialization of the service endpoint; or if any |
| * illegal context has been provided in the init method |
| */ |
| public abstract void init(Object context) throws ServiceException; |
| |
| /** |
| * JAX-RPC runtime system ends the lifecycle of a service endpoint instance by |
| * invoking the destroy method. The service endpoint releases its resources in |
| * the implementation of the destroy method. |
| */ |
| public abstract void destroy(); |
| } |
